Exploring Chevy Volt’s Power Loss Issue

Chevy Volt models from 2016 to 2019 are grappling with a major problem of unexpected power loss while driving. This concerning issue, associated with the Battery Energy Control Module (BECM), has triggered investigations by the NHTSA. In addition to affecting road safety, it has a considerable impact on driver confidence. Reported Problem

The problem centers on unexpected power loss due to BECM in Chevy Volt vehicles, raising safety concerns for the owners. This crucial component is responsible for managing the vehicle’s battery system. Owners experiencing power loss incidents have pointed to malfunctions or failures within the BECM. This results in the vehicles’ unexpected stalls, reduced power states, or no-start conditions. These issues have raised concerns about the reliability and functionality of the BECM within the vehicle’s power management system.

Investigation Insights

The NHTSA investigation into sudden power loss in Chevy Volt models from 2016 to 2019 revealed concerning incidents reported by owners, ranging from stalls to reduced power while driving. The focus centered on the Battery Energy Control Module (BECM) as the likely culprit behind these issues. This prompted actions by General Motors (GM) through technical bulletins aimed at BECM replacement and reprogramming. However, delays in solutions for affected owners persisted. These delays sparked safety concerns and legal actions, highlighting the urgency for swift and comprehensive resolutions.
